AI Snapshot

Creative Fabrica (creativefabrica.com) is a digital marketplace and subscription platform offering over one million unique premium creative assets, including fonts, graphics, and crafts. It also provides AI-powered tools for generating images, videos, audio, and 3D content. Subscriptions grant unlimited access to all current and future tools along with commercial use rights. The platform targets designers, creatives, and makers working on personal and commercial projects.

What is Creative Fabrica?

Creative Fabrica is a digital subscription platform and asset marketplace available at creativefabrica.com. It positions itself as an advanced AI-powered creative studio offering access to over one million unique premium designs alongside a suite of generative AI tools. It operates across the SaaS, Media & Entertainment, and Technology categories, serving designers, crafters, and other creative professionals.
